General Rate Case Filing
On April 2, 2012 Avista Corporation submitted a filing seeking Commission authorization to increase its rates and charges for its electric and natural gas services in the the state of Washington. In this filing the Company has requested an overall increase in billed rates of 8.8% or $41.0 million for electric service. As part of its filing, the Company proposed an Energy Recovery Mechanism Rebate of 2.9%. The net effect of the general rate increase coupled with the ERM Rebate is an overall increase in billed electric rates of 5.9%.
In addition, the Company requested an overall increase of 6.8% in billed rates or $10.1 million for natural gas service.
